mostra di piùPower is the ability to remain authentically yourself regardless of the audience.Because leadership isn't limited by knowledge.It's limited by the state of the nervous system applying that knowledge.Authentic power doesn't say, Nobody gets to affect me.It says:
Nobody else gets to define me.You can listen without surrendering yourself.You can be challenged without collapsing.You can be different without apologizing.You can take up space without taking space away from someone else.And you can allow another person to stand fully in their power without believing theirs threatens yours.Maybe power was never something you needed to acquire.Maybe it's what remains when you finally stop abandoning yourself.
